The Oprah Winfrey Network (OWN, also known as the OWN Network) is an American multinational basic cable television network which launched on January 1, 2011, effectively replacing the Discovery Health Channel, which one month later merged with FitTV to become Discovery Fit & Health (now known as Discovery Life).
All Rise is an American legal drama television series created and developed by Greg Spottiswood for CBS and later the Oprah Winfrey Network. It aired from September 23, 2019 to November 18, 2023. Raising Whitley is an American reality television series that premiered April 20, 2013, on the Oprah Winfrey Network. [1] [2] [3] The show ran for four seasons and in 2016, for unknown reasons, the OWN Network decided not to renew the series for a fifth season.
